Frozen TofuFrozen tofu is made by freezing fresh tofu, which develops a honeycomb-like structure inside with many pores and good elasticity. It can be cooked with various ingredients, offering a rich and diverse texture.

Mutton Stew with BonesYang Jiezi is a dish featuring lamb leg bones as the main ingredient, typically cooked with offal and blood in water or broth. It's simmered slowly after blanching the meat to remove odor, then stewed with ginger, scallions, star anise, and other spices until tender and flavorful.
